Growing pressure on modern agriculture to balance productivity with sustainability continues to steer attention toward safer crop protection methods. Farmers worldwide are increasingly evaluating long-term soil health, residue-free production, and regulatory compliance when selecting pest control solutions. This shift has created a favorable environment for natural and biologically derived products, which are proving essential in reducing chemical dependency without compromising yield quality.
The global Biorational Pesticides Market is advancing steadily as policymakers and consumers demand eco-friendlier agricultural inputs. Designed to target pests with precision while minimizing environmental harm, these products align with the expanding global commitment to regenerative and organic farming practices. As a result, manufacturers are broadening their portfolios with microbial, botanical, and semiochemical-based solutions to meet diverse crop protection needs.
Current evaluations of Biorational Pesticides Market Size indicate notable acceleration due to increased adoption among small and large-scale growers. Rising awareness campaigns, improved training programs, and technological improvements in formulation stability are making these products more accessible and effective across a wider range of climatic and soil conditions. From horticulture to broadacre crops, the use of biorational products is expanding as growers recognize their compatibility with integrated pest management strategies.
Another major driver is the rising demand for residue-free food. Retailers and exporters are enforcing stricter standards that limit the use of conventional pesticides. Biorational alternatives help producers maintain compliance while enhancing their marketability in global trade channels. Moreover, developments in biological fermentation, extraction technology, and pheromone synthesis are boosting product reliability, enabling better pest resistance management.
Regional demand is also evolving, with North America and Europe maintaining strong leadership due to established organic sectors. However, Asia-Pacific is emerging as a high-growth region, driven by agricultural modernization and increasing government support for sustainable farming. Latin America shows promising expansion, especially in fruit, vegetable, and plantation crop sectors.
Looking ahead, ongoing research collaborations and continued emphasis on sustainable intensification of agriculture are expected to shape the market’s long-term trajectory.
